Delicious and healthy brownies made with ripe bananas, perfect for satisfying your sweet tooth without the guilt.

Ingredients
Brownie Ingredients
- 3medium ripe bananas
- 1cupoats
- 1cupcocoa powder
- 1cupnut butter
- 1cuphoney or maple syrup
- 1tspvanilla extract
- 1tspbaking powder
- 1pinchsalt

How to make Healthy Banana Brownies
Preparation
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king dish with parchment paper.
In a mixing bowl, mash the ripe bananas until smooth.
Add the oats, cocoa powder, nut butter, honey or maple syrup, vanilla extract, baking powder, and salt to the mashed bananas.
Mix all the ingredients until well combined.
Pour the brownie batter into the prepared baking dish and spread it evenly.
B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
Allow the brownies to cool before cutting them into squares.

Tips & Tricks
Make sure to use ripe bananas for the best flavor and sweetness.
You can add nuts or chocolate chips for extra texture and flavor.
Store the brownies in an airtight container to keep them fresh.
FAQS
Can I use other sweeteners instead of honey or maple syrup?
Yes, you can use agave syrup or coconut sugar as alternatives.
Are these brownies gluten-free?
Yes, as long as you use certified gluten-free oats.
How long do these brownies last?
They can last up to a week when stored in an airtight container.
Can I freeze these brownies?
Yes, you can freeze them for up to three months.
What can I substitute for nut butter?
You can use sunflower seed butter or tahini as a nut-free alternative.
